.mnu_man{
	width:100%;
	height:40px;
	background:#efefef;
	border-bottom:4px solid #d5d5d5;
}
.mnu_man .in{
	width:1200px;
	margin:0 auto;
	text-align:center;
	background:url(menu_bg.jpg) no-repeat left top;
	height:36px;
}

.mnu_man  .n:hover{
	color:#423e78;
	border-bottom:3px solid #423e78;
}
.mnu_man  .n{
	 color:#474748;
	 float:left;
	 height:36px;     line-height:36px;
    padding:0px 15px; font-size: 16px;
}
.nav{width:1200px;text-align:right;position:absolute;z-index:99;}
.menu_box{ height:36px; position:relative; z-index:2}
 
.menu{ float:right; line-height:16px; }
a.bnav,.bnav a.ba{ display:block;float:left;height:36px; color: #000;}
a.bnav:hover,.bnav a.ba:hover,.bnav_hover{ 	color:#423e78; border-bottom:3px solid #423e78;}

.menu dl{ float:left;padding:0;margin:0;}
a.home{ float:left;}
.menu dt{ cursor:pointer; float:left; height:36px;
    margin:0 5px;
    width: auto;
    font-size: 16px;
    line-height:36px;
    padding:0px 16px;
    text-decoration: none;	}
.menu dt.ind{
	background:none;}
  .menu s{ background:url(home.gif) no-repeat; height:28px; width:36px; display:block;  margin-bottom:2px}
  .bnav b{ display:none; background:url(menu_jt.gif) no-repeat center 0; height:8px;  width:33px}
  .menu dd{ position:absolute; top:0px; left:0; width:976px; display:none; }
  
  .snav_box{ float:left; position:relative; margin-left:46px}
  .snav_box .snav{display:block; float:left;color:#fff;font-size: 16px; margin:0px 5px;display:inline; }

  .snav_box .snav:hover {color:#fff; background:#625ca1}
.snav_box .snav.er:hover{ background: none;}
.snav_box .snav.er a{ color: #fff; display: inline-block;padding:0px 5px;}
.snav_box .snav.er a:hover{background:#625ca1;color:#fff;}
  .snav b{display:none; background:url(menu_jt2.gif) no-repeat center 0; height:8px;  width:33px}
  .snav li{margin:0 10px; height:36px;line-height:36px; float:left}

  .snav .view{ height:36px; width:1200px;margin-left:-46px; background:#423e78; left:0; top:36px; position:absolute; display:none; z-index:9999999 }
  .snav .view ul{ float:left;}
  .snav .view .fuck{font-size: 16px;line-height:36px;padding:0px 10px;margin-left:5px;cursor:pointer; color:#fff; }
  .snav .view .fuck:hover{background:#625ca1; color:#fff; line-height:36px; }

  .pull_nav{ height:36px;width:100%; background:#524c8d; display:none; position:relative; overflow: inherit !important;}
  .pull_nav dd{display:none; width:1200px; left:50%; margin-left:-600px; position:absolute;}
  .pull_nav dd .hk{ background:url(hk.gif) no-repeat; height:24px; width:174px; margin-top:22px}
dd#m_51{margin-left:-300px;}
dd#m_195{margin-left:70px;}
dd#m_78{margin-left:-550px;}
dd#m_4{margin-left:200px;}
dd#m_3{margin-left:200px;}
dd#m_2{margin-left:0px;}


